Secretly Group is a family of American independent record labels based in Bloomington, Indiana. The group is made up of Secretly Canadian, Jagjaguwar, and Dead Oceans, as well as a 50% stake in Merge Records. Secretly Canadian, the first of the labels, was formed in 1996 by brothers Chris and Ben Swanson, Eric Weddle, and Jonathan Cargill. Their first release was a re-issue of an album by June Panic. Weddle later left to form label Family Vineyard; the remaining trio were joined by Darius Van Arman, as well as his label Jagjaguwar, in 1999. The two labels had worked closely before Jagjaguwar's offices moved to Bloomington to work alongside Secretly Canadian's.

In February 2007, the partners behind Secretly Canadian and Jagjaguwar, along with Phil Waldorf, former label manager of Misra Records, announced a third label, Dead Oceans. The three labels share offices and staff in Bloomington, IN; however, they maintain distinct and separate aesthetic visions. In June 2013, The Numero Group, an existing re-issuer out of Chicago, joined forces with Secretly Canadian and the collection of labels known as Secretly Group. In 2025, it acquired a 50% stake in the influential independent label Merge Records.

All five labels are distributed by Secretly Group's in-house distribution arm, Secretly Distribution.

The All Flowers Group is a label group which is part of the Secretly Group family of record labels.

drink sum wtr

drink sum wtr is an American independent record label founded in 2022. It operates under the All Flowers Group. drink sum wtr was founded in May 2022 by music executive Nigil Mack, Chris Swanson and Sam Valenti IV. It primarily releases music in genres such as hip hop and R&B. Its first signing was Queens-based rapper Deem Spencer in 2022, followed by poet Aja Monet.

In 2023, drink sum wtr signed Annahstasia, who later released the album Tether and the EP Surface Tension under the label. In 2025, the label signed Yaya Bey, and released her album Do It Afraid. Other artists the label has signed include Gareth Donkin, Your Grandparents, JEMS!, Seafood Sam, Halima, St. Panther, Kari Faux, THEY., Elujay, Aundrey Guillaume, and Say She She.
